Bags

From carry-all totes to everyday crossbody bags, our selection of luxury leather handbags have been crafted to be your dependable (and stylish) companion - wherever life takes you.

Filters 58 products
58 products
Open
58 products
1 Colour
£1,195
£895
£350
3 Colours
£1,195

Low Stock

3 Colours
£1,195
3 Colours
£1,295
2 Colours
£350
2 Colours
£1,050
2 Colours
£1,595
£795
2 Colours
£765
3 Colours
£1,295
4 Colours
£1,550
2 Colours
£495
4 Colours
£1,550
£1,095
2 Colours
£765
3 Colours
£1,695
4 Colours
£235
4 Colours
£1,550
4 Colours
£1,350

Low Stock

4 Colours
£1,150
3 Colours
£1,695
3 Colours
£1,295
3 Colours
£1,695
2 Colours
£1,395
3 Colours
£1,295
3 Colours
£695
4 Colours
£1,150
3 Colours
£695
£1,250
3 Colours
£1,295
3 Colours
£1,395
3 Colours
£695
£950
4 Colours
£1,150